Yoga & Fascial Release

Fascia is the connective tissue that surrounds your muscles, blood vessels, and nerves. When it's healthy, fascia allows your muscles to slide and glide as you move. But when your fascia gets tight and stuck, it can restrict your movement. In this class, you'll learn how to release the layers of fascia in your body using special props, techniques, and yoga poses. We will also practice mindful ways to move that are healthy and safe for your hips, knees, and low back. Everyone is welcome.

Beginner Pilates

Pilates strengthens and stretches all the major muscles of our body including abdominals, hamstrings, lower and upper back, hips, arms, and legs. We also focus on our core muscles, our "powerhouse.”

 

Have you wanted to try Pilates? Or brush up on your previous experiences? In this class, we will cover the basics of Classical Pilates Mat Exercises each week. Modifications will be offered as needed so that you can safely access each exercise.
